I have the Chubby 2 Synth and a Muhle STF. Both have really soft tips. I give a slight nod to Simpson.
If you like easy splay, then Muhle all the way. The Simpson has tons of backbone and takes some effort to use. Mine is lifted at 54 mm.
Both are really nice but if you want more backbone stick with the Simpson.
